What types of projects and investigations can I expect to work on as an entry level forensic electrical engineer?

As an entry level forensic electrical engineer, you'll typically assist with investigations involving electrical failures, fires, product malfunctions, or accidents. Your daily responsibilities may include collecting and analyzing evidence, conducting site inspections, documenting findings, and supporting senior engineers in preparing detailed reports. You'll also collaborate with cross-disciplinary teams, such as fire investigators, legal professionals, and insurance adjusters. This role provides hands-on experience with real-world cases and offers a clear pathway for professional development and specialization within the forensic engineering field.

What does an entry level forensic electrical engineer do?

An entry level forensic electrical engineer investigates electrical systems, equipment, and components to determine the causes of failures, malfunctions, fires, or accidents. They assist more experienced engineers in collecting evidence, analyzing data, and preparing technical reports for legal or insurance purposes. Their work often involves on-site inspections, laboratory testing, and collaboration with other experts to reconstruct incidents and support litigation or claims. Strong analytical skills, attention to detail, and a solid foundation in electrical engineering principles are essential for this role.

What is the difference between Entry Level Forensic Electrical Engineer vs Entry Level Electrical Engineer?

AspectEntry Level Forensic Electrical EngineerEntry Level Electrical Engineer
Required CredentialsBachelor's in Electrical Engineering, possibly some forensic certificationsBachelor's in Electrical Engineering, PE exam not typically required at entry level
Work EnvironmentForensic labs, courtrooms, consulting firmsDesign firms, manufacturing, utility companies
Industry UsageLegal cases, accident investigations, forensic analysisProduct design, system development, infrastructure projects

Entry Level Forensic Electrical Engineers focus on investigating electrical failures and providing expert testimony, often working in legal or forensic settings. In contrast, Entry Level Electrical Engineers typically work on designing and developing electrical systems in various industries. While both roles require a bachelor's degree in electrical engineering, forensic engineers may pursue additional certifications related to forensic analysis. The work environments differ, with forensic engineers often in labs or courtrooms, whereas general electrical engineers work in design or manufacturing settings.
